chronic wrongdoing... which results in a general loosening of the ties of civilized society, may in america, as elsewhere, ultimately require intervention by some civilized nation, and in the western hemisphere the adherence of the united states to the monroe doctrine may force the united states, however reluctantly, in flagrant cases of such wrongdoing... to the exercise of an international police power. - president theodore roosevelt, 1904
12
president roosevelt issued this statement in response to -
the construction of a canal in panama
public outcry regarding war between russia and japan
spanish efforts to suppress a rebellion in cuba
the threat of european intervention in latin america
clear all
Theodore Roosevelt's statement relates to the United States' role as an international police - power in the Western Hemisphere under the Monroe Doctrine. The threat of European intervention in Latin America was a key concern that led to the Roosevelt Corollary to the Monroe Doctrine. The US saw itself as having the right to intervene in Latin American affairs to prevent European intervention.
